What is the pre-game procedure for Two-Headed Giant tournaments?

0

Teams should do the following before playing: 1. Players should be seated with the primary player to the right of his or her teammate. 2. Players shuffle their decks. 3. Players present their decks to their opponents for additional shuffling and cutting. 4. If an opponent has shuffled a players deck, that player may make one final cut. 5. Each player draws seven cards. 6. Each player, in turn order, decides whether to mulligan. Once all mulligans are resolved, the game can begin.
